    Abstract: The present invention relates to determination of a state of a vehicle on a road portion. The vehicle includes an Automated Driving System (ADS) feature. At first, map data associated with the road portion, positioning data indicating a pose of the vehicle on the road, and sensor data of the vehicle are obtained. Then, a plurality of filters for the road portion are initialized. Further, one or more sensor data point(s) in the obtained sensor data is associated to a corresponding map-element of the obtained map data to determine one or more normalized similarity score(s). Now, based on the determined one or more normalized similarity score(s), one or more multivariate time-series data are also determined and provided as input to a trained machine-learning algorithm. Then, one of the initialized filters is selected by the machine learning algorithm to indicate a current state of the vehicle on the road portion.

    Abstract: The present disclosure relates to a method for determining a state of a vehicle on a road portion having two or more lanes. The method comprises obtaining map data associated with the road portion and positioning data indicating a position of the vehicle on the road and a sensor data from a sensor system of the vehicle. The method further comprises initializing a filter per lane of the road portion based on the obtained map data, the obtained positioning data, and the obtained sensor data, wherein each filter indicates an estimated state of the vehicle on the road portion. Then, selecting one of the initialized filters using a trained machine-learning algorithm, configured to use the obtained map data, the positioning data, the sensor data, and each estimated state as indicated by each filter as input and to output a current state of the vehicle on the road portion.

    Abstract: The present disclosure relates to a method for determining a vehicle pose, predicting a pose (xk, yk, ?k) of vehicle on a map based on sensor data acquired by a vehicle localization system, transforming a set of map road references of a segment of a digital map from a global coordinate system to an image-frame coordinate system of a vehicle-mounted camera based on map data and predicted pose of the vehicle. The transformed set of map road references form a set of polylines in image-frame coordinate system. Identifying a set of corresponding image road reference features in an image acquired by vehicle mounted camera, where each identified road references feature defines a set of measurement coordinates (xi, yi) in image-frame. Projecting each of identified set of image road reference features onto formed set of polylines in order to obtain a set of projection points.
